Getting to a Big Yes

Firehouse Phones worked with a suburban chamber of commerce to renew a 1% sales tax in 2022. Firehouse built and executed the entire campaign plan, sending nearly 400,000 text messages and running a telephone town hall with 14,000 participants. The measure garnered 184,957 “yes” votes and passed with 63.89%, the highest in two decades.

Voter Victory

The firm was a vital part of renewing the Municipal Option Sales Tax in the City of Atlanta during the 2024 cycle. Firehouse developed messaging for the initiative and sent more than 400,000 texts and calls to voters, in conjunction with several rounds of direct mail. The referendum passed with 75% of the vote.

A Win and an Award

Firehouse activated thousands of African American women voters in Maryland, Virginia, Texas, Michigan and Wisconsin ahead of the 2022 election. We created a character called “Ava” to share a compelling narrative throughout the program. Ava reached voters via automated call and SMS, driving them to the client’s website for more information and voting resources. The program earned a Reed Award at the 2023 ceremony in Las Vegas.

Major Player for a Winning Mayor

Firehouse was a key player in re-electing Atlanta Mayor Andre Dickens in November 2025. The company made nearly 200,000 calls to voters highlighting the mayor’s record on issues like affordable housing, infrastructure, and support for small businesses. Dickens won with a commanding 86% of the vote.

Minimizing Misinformation

Our client needed to connect with thousands of low-income families in Maine and Mississippi to cut through a fog of misinformation about the Child Tax Credit in 2021, so that they could take advantage before the program expired. We worked to craft scripts that provided clear, useful information. The program delivered 54,000 texts and phone calls by the deadline, helping thousands of families utilize this vital tax credit.

Polling the Public

Firehouse was contracted by a polling firm to conduct survey outreach among various groups of constituents. Throughout 2024 Firehouse Phones sent over half a million text messages to California residents, surveying them on community issues such as K-12 public education.
